Module Name: src Committed By: uebayasi Date: Tue Dec 8 15:18:42 UTC 2009 Modified Files: src/share/mk: bsd.lib.mk bsd.prog.mk Log Message: When PROGS / LIBS are used, you can pass each PROG / LIB specific parameters to ${LD} via: ${_LDADD.${PROG}} ${_LDFLAGS.${PROG}} ${_LDSTATIC.${PROG}} ${_LDADD.${LIB}} ${_LDFLAGS.${LIB}} OTOH you can't pass parameters to ${CC}, because in suffix rules make(1) only knows the name of ${.IMPSRC} and ${.TARGET}; it's users' responsivility to define ${CC} parameters to all the sources of a given ${PROG} / ${LIB}.
